Most of Kansas is, as you might have read in a book somewhere, rather flat. The Flint Hills area is one of the few exceptions. As you drive along I-35 between Emporia and El Dorado, there are several spots where you can look off to the side and watch the land drop away into a valley, then roll out miles and miles into the horizon. I've been trying for more than a decade to get a pic that captures the depth and three-dimensional feel; this is my latest attempt, and it did a better job than most, but it's still missing too much. :(
